Abstract

Official abstract text for this publication.

The present disclosure relates generally to novel biomass pyrolysis processes and systems that decrease entrainment of char and other contaminants with the pyrolysis vapors as a direct consequence of the biomass feedstock comprising particles that are larger than a defined minimum diameter. The biomass feedstock may optionally be compressed to form feedstock pellets that are larger than a defined minimum diameter.

First claim

Opening claim text (preview).

The invention claimed is: 1. A biomass pyrolysis process, comprising the steps of: (a) sizing a biomass feedstock to consist of particles having a diameter ranging from 300 microns to 500 microns; (b) pyrolyzing the biomass feedstock in a reactor for a residence time of less than 5 seconds, wherein the pyrolyzing forms products comprising a primary gaseous product and char; (c) passing the primary gaseous product out of the reactor, and condensing the primary gaseous product to produce a pyrolysis oil that is characterized by a total metal content (in ppm) that is six percent or less of the total metal content (in ppm) of the biomass feedstock.
